The large bulge in the chest on one side is the crop. Their food boob lol. It's where they store their food after they eat. You'll typically see it enlarged before they roost and itll deflate over night 😊 with the area on your girls back you can try a chicken saddle. They sell them on etsy and it would protect the area from further damage.
 
Will that help with infection!??
It wouldnt help with infection but it would stop the others from packing at it and inflaming the area. Any time a chicken sees a red spot they'll continue to peck at it, so you'll need to protect the area for it to heal. As for preventing/treating infection theres many topical sprays or creams for it. Some swear by blukote or triple antibiotic ointment (without any -caine products in it). Cant think of the other spray at the moment I've heard a lot about. I've treated a bumble foot infection on my duck with iodine as well.
